In [16]:
# -*- coding: utf-8 -*-

import numpy as np
import matplotlib.pyplot as plt

Le calcul de la vitesse terminale de chute d'une particule en présence d'un contre courant ascendant ne peut se faire que de façon itérative dans la mesure où il est nécessaire de connaître cette même vitesse terminale pour évaluer le Reynolds particulaire et donc le régime d'écoulement. Le Reynolds particulaire noté $Re_p$ est donné par :

$\large{Re_{p}=\frac{\rho_{l}\lvert V_{l} - V_{t} \rvert d}{\mu}}$

$\rho_{l}$ est la masse volumique du liquide.

$V_{l}$ est la vitesse du liquide.

$V_{t}$ est la vitesse terminale de la particule.

$d$ est le diamètre de la particule.

$\mu$ est la viscosité du fluide.

Comme on peut le constater, il est nécessaire de $V_t$ pour calculer $Re_p$ et vice-versa puisque $Re_p$ est nécessaire pour choisir le coefficient de trainée à utiliser pour le calcul de la vitesse terminale de chute.

Ce qui nous intéresse ici c'est de savoir si la particule va êstre entrainée par le contre-courant. La réponse à cette question dépend de l'inégalité suivante:

$V_{l} > V_{t}$

Selon le régime d'écoulement considéré, il existe trois façon différentes de calculer la vitesse terminale de chute d'une particule.

En laminaire, quand $Re_{p} < 2$:

$\large{V_{t} = \frac{1000 \times g \times d^{2} \times (\rho_{p}-\rho_{l})}{18.\mu}}$

En régime transitoire, quand $2 < Re_{p} < 500$ :

$\large{V_{t} = \frac{3,54 \times g^{0,71} d^{1,14} (\rho_{p}-\rho_{l})^{0,71}}{\rho_{l}^{0,29}\mu^{0,43}}}$

Enfin en régime turbulent, aussi appelé régime de Newton, lorsque $500 < Re_{p}$:

$\large{V_{t} = 1,74 \sqrt{\frac{g \times d \times (\rho_{p}-\rho_{l})}{\rho_{l}}}}$

Supposons maintenant que le fluide soit de l'eau ($\rho_{l}=1000Kg/m^{3}$ et $\mu=0.001Pa.s$). Et disons que cette eau circule dans un espace annulaire d'entrefer $30mm$ à un débit de $21L/h$. La vitesse de circulation du liquide est alors donnée par:

$\large{V_{l} = \frac{Q}{S}}$

$Q$ est le débit de $21L/h$, soit $\large{Q = \frac{21 \times 10^{-3}}{3600} = 5.833333333333334 \times 10^{-6} m^{3}/s}$

In [17]:
Q = 21e-03/3600
print(Q)

5.833333333333334e-06


La surface S est la section de l'entrefer annulaire.

$\large{S = \pi.R_{ext}^{2} - \pi.R_{int}^{2} = 0.016022122533307946 m^{2}}$

In [18]:
S = (np.pi * 0.1**2) - (np.pi * 0.07**2)
print(S)

0.016022122533307946


Finalement la vitesse de circulation vaut :

In [19]:
V_l = Q / S
print(V_l)

0.0003640799351775384


In [28]:
# Fixons au préalable la valeurs des constantes physiques 

d = 3e-07
rho_p = 4000
rho_l = 1000
mu = 0.001

En décidant d'appliquer les formules de calcul de la vitesse terminale sans connaître à priori le régime d'écoulement on obtient les vitesses suivantes:

In [29]:
V_t_lam = (1000 * 9.81 * d**2 * (rho_p - rho_l))/(18 * mu)
print(V_t_lam)

0.00014714999999999997


In [22]:
V_t_trans = (3.54 * 9.81**0.71 * d**1.14 * (rho_p - rho_l)**0.71) / (rho_l**0.29 * mu**0.43)
print(V_t_trans)

0.00014515912715578247


In [23]:
V_t_turb = 1.74 * np.sqrt((9.81 * d * (rho_p - rho_l)) /(rho_l))
print(V_t_turb)

0.0029850003015075223


Reste ensuite à calculant les Reynolds particulaires à partir de ces vitesses pour voir lequel est cohérent avec la théorie.

In [30]:
Re_lam = (rho_l * abs(V_l - V_t_lam) * d) / (mu)
print(Re_lam)

6.507898055326151e-05


Le Reynolds respecte bien la condition selon laquelle $\large{Re_{p}<2}$. Le régime est très vraisemblablement laminaire. Et donc la relation à utiliser pour le calcul de la vitesse terminale de chute est la formule pour le régime laminaire. 

Vérifions néanmoins que l'utilisation des 2 autres formules conduit à des incohérences.

In [25]:
Re_trans = (rho_l * abs(V_l - V_t_trans) * d) / (mu)
print(Re_trans)

2.1892080802175592e-05


Ici $Re_{p}<2$ au lieu d'être supérieur à 2. Voici la première incohérence attendue. Nous ne sommes pas en régime intermédiaire. Faisons aussi la vérifcation pour le régime turbulent.

In [26]:
Re_turb = (rho_l * abs(V_l - V_t_turb) * d) / (mu)
print(Re_turb)

0.0002620920366329983


Voici la seconde incohérence. Le nombre de Reynolds particulaire n'est pas supérieur à 500 donc nous ne sommes pas non plus en régime turbulent.

Maintenant que l'on sait précisément quelle est la vitesse terminale de chute, il est aussi possible de dire si la particule va être entrainée ou non.

Dans ce cas précis $V_t<<V_l$ donc la particule est entrainée.

Faisons maintenant le raisonnement dans l'autre sens. Partons de la vitesse de circulation dans l'espace annulaire pour déterminer quelle est la plus grosse particule qui peut être entrainée.

Nous savons que nous sommes en régime laminaire. Une particule est entrainée lorsque sa vitesse terminale est inférieure à la vitesse du liquide, soit:

$\large{\frac{1000 \times g \times d^{2} \times (\rho_{p}-\rho_{l})}{18.\mu} < V_{l}}$

L'idée est d'avoir une information sur le diamètre max qui puisse être entraîné. On isole d et on obtient:

$\large{d < \sqrt{\frac{18 . \mu . V_{l}}{1000 . g  . (\rho_{p}-\rho_{l})}}}$

In [27]:
d_lim = np.sqrt((18 * mu * V_l)/(1000 * 9.81 * (rho_p - rho_l)))
print(d_lim)

4.7188860913970295e-07


![](figure.pdf)